General Information

Description

  • Reduce maintenance time – bodies remain on pipe/header; quick quarter-turn removes/installs spray tips with automatic alignment
  • Save on nozzle replacement costs – bodies can be reused, only spray tips are replaced
  • Spray angles: Standard – 43° to 91°, Narrow – 15° or 30°, Wide – 102° to 120°
  • Uniform spray distribution from .10 to 19.4 gpm (.38 to 72 lpm)
  • Operating pressures up to 300 psi (20 bar)
  • Choice of metal or ProMax materials. ProMax features:
    • ProMax material, a special grade of polypropylene, resists build-up and chemical attack; for use up to 150 psi (10 bar)
    • Internal O-ring provides a positive seal between the body and tip; seal remains attached to tip eliminating accidental loss
    • Optional external O-ring protects nozzle from contaminants
    • Tips are color-coded for easy flow rate identification
